Dhaka, Mar 16 (UNB) - With a view to ensuring emergency healthcare for the secretariat employees, a new ambulance has been provided to the Bangladesh Secretariat Clinic.
Health Minister Dr AFM Ruhal Haque today (Tuesday) handed over the keys to the ambulance to the civil surgeon stationed at the clinic. He said the ambulance has been provided to ensure that emergency healthcare is now available for the secretariat officers and employees.
“In particular, it will have to be ensured that this ambulance will be used for carrying the referred patients from here,” he said.
Earlier, the Health Minister visited the different units at the clinic including pathology, dental and eye units, the emergency unit and the dispensary. It’s notable that the present government has distributed hundreds of ambulances to the various upazila health complexes and medical centers.
Among other, health secretary Sheikh Altaf Ali was present on the occasion.
